CI Week, which stands for Celebrate Innovation, happens annually at DMACC West and is always standing room only. The digital stream hits 65,000 live viewers every year. We dig into the event's history, and discuss the overview of topics. For example, Susan Kilrain's "GI Jane" experience where she demanded she complete the men's requirements, and Dr. Alan Stern who was on the Titan Submersible's last successful dive before it imploded exploring the Titanic wreckage.
